  • Mary L. Sims, Esquire, is an attorney practicing in Estates, Business and related areas in New Jersey and Pennsylvania for the past twenty-six years, and has been teaching at Arcadia University and Manor College for twenty years.? Her J.D. degree is from Pepperdine University School of Law and she has a Masters in Moral Theology from Saint Charles Seminary in Philadelphia.? She dedicates her time not only to teaching but in doing service in the community.? She has contributed time and energy to many local endeavors, including but not limited to: the Career Wardrobe (helping women return to the workforce) and Wills for Heroes (providing estate documents for first responders); she also provides advice and support to shelters and other non-profit organizations.? She works with Rotary International and other NGO’s at the University level to help students make a connection between professional life and a commitment to others, and she writes and speaks on the subjects of law, global business ethics, and social responsibility.

  • The firm currently known as Duffy, North, Wilson, Thomas & Nicholson, LLP ("Duffy North") was established in 1928 and previously known as Duffy, McTighe & McElhone and Duffy, North, Duffy & Wilson. The firm's origins go back to Edward B. Duffy, Esquire who was admitted to the Montgomery County Bar in 1927. In 1960, the office located at 104 North York Road was purchased, the existing structure was renovated and the firm moved from its original location at 110 South York Road.
